The title of KING & QUEEN of Vegas will be given to the 1st Male and 1st Female who cross the line and present their completed manifest, regardless of bike type. They will split the CASH PRIZE!
1st Fixed (Men’s & Women’s) wins a $50 BONUS! Word.
This will be a challenging yet fun race through the streets and back alleys of Las Vegas. Get ready to hit some popular spots, out of the way stretches and the fabulous Las Vegas Strip. Jetforce won the race last year and, by tradition, has designed a course worthy of the crown.
The checkpoints will be announced before the start. Racers must return to the finish with each checkpoint marked off their manifest in order to place. There is no set route. Checkpoints will be manned by race marshals. A commemorative manifest/map will be provided to each racer, but they are limited so get there early.

TRAFIK spent our Labor Day weekend chillin at the Lord of Griffith IV race in Griffith Park. Great day, hot as fu*k . The 105 guys and girls who competed in this race really had their work cut out for them. Three killer laps of the park, which means three killer climbs and descents. Fixed gear only – you know how is goes.
This year’s winners were HERN – 1st, WILLO JUAREZ – 2nd, IVAN DELGADO – 3rd. The “Lady of Griffith” was awarded to MEI.
